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: Use about 3-4 breasts; adjust according to your crowd size for optimal satisfaction.
Cooked Rice: Any variety works; I prefer white or brown rice for their comforting texture.
Black Beans: Canned are perfect; just rinse them to eliminate excess sodium and boost flavor.
Salsa: Choose your favorite kind—mild or spicy—to add that burst of flavor.
Taco Seasoning: A wonderful blend not only spices things up but also saves time—no measuring required!
Shredded Cheese: Go for Mexican blend or cheddar; who doesn’t love gooey cheese?
Sour Cream: For that creamy touch; feel free to substitute with Greek yogurt for added protein.
Fresh Cilantro: Optional but adds brightness; use according to your herb-lover status!

How to Make Chicken Burrito Casserole Bake
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with nonstick spray for easy cleanup later. Season chicken breasts generously with salt and pepper before cooking.
Cook the chicken in a skillet over medium heat until golden brown on both sides, about 6-7 minutes per side. Ensure it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C) so everyone stays happy and healthy.
Once cooked, shred the chicken using two forks while it’s still warm; this makes it easier. Mix the shredded chicken with black beans, cooked rice, salsa, and taco seasoning until everything is evenly coated.
Spread half of the mixture into your greased baking dish and top with half of the shredded cheese. Layer on the remaining chicken mixture and finish with more cheese on top—because let’s be honest, you can never have too much cheese.
Cover the dish with aluminum foil and bake for 25 minutes. Remove the foil and bake an additional 10-15 minutes until bubbly and golden brown. Your kitchen will smell heavenly right about now!
Once out of the oven, let it cool slightly before garnishing with fresh cilantro and dollops of sour cream. Allowing it to rest helps all those flavors meld together beautifully while preventing fiery tongues!

Storing & Reheating
Store leftover casserole in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at it in the oven at 350°F until warmed through.

Chicken Burrito Casserole Bake
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Yield: Serves 8

Ingredients
- 3–4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 cups cooked rice (white or brown)
- 1 can (15 oz) black beans, rinsed
- 1 cup salsa (mild or spicy)
- 2 tbsp taco seasoning
- 2 cups shredded cheese (Mexican blend or cheddar)
- 1 cup sour cream (or Greek yogurt)
- Fresh cilantro (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- Season chicken with salt and pepper; cook in a skillet over medium heat until golden brown, about 6-7 minutes per side. Ensure it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
- Shred the cooked chicken and mix it with black beans, cooked rice, salsa, and taco seasoning.
- Layer half of the mixture in the baking dish; top with half of the shredded cheese. Add the remaining mixture and finish with more cheese.
- Cover with foil and bake for 25 minutes; remove fo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es until bubbly and golden.
- Let cool slightly before garnishing with cilantro and sour cream. Serve hot.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 40 minutes
